The 100G transceivers are high performance, cost effective modules supporting dual data-rate of 100G QSFP28 1294~1310NM SM 10KM LC LWDM.
The transceiver consists of three sections: a FP laser transmitter, a PIN photodiode integrated with a trans-impedance preamplifier (TIA) and MCU control unit. All modules satisfy class I laser safety requirements.

The transceivers are compatible with SFP Multi-Source Agreement (MSA) and SFF-8472. For further information, please refer to SFP MSA.
